About Harry Potter Death Eaters Rising

Play together and assemble teams of wizards to fight the growing threat of Voldemort.

Card GameDiceFantasyMovies / TV / Radio theme

Mechanics: Card Drafting, Cooperative Game, Dice Rolling, Push Your Luck · Designer: Patrick Marino, Andrew Wolf

Harry Potter Death Eaters Rising FAQ

How many players is Harry Potter Death Eaters Rising?
Harry Potter Death Eaters Rising plays with 2–4 players, ages 11 and up.
How long does Harry Potter Death Eaters Rising take to play?
A game of Harry Potter Death Eaters Rising takes 45–90 min, at medium-light complexity (2.3/5 on BoardGameGeek).
Is Harry Potter Death Eaters Rising any good?
Harry Potter Death Eaters Rising rates 7.3/10 from 449 BoardGameGeek ratings. It is a card game / dice game built around card drafting, cooperative game, dice rolling.
